Eurowings features and specs

  • Affordable Pricing
    Eurowings is known for offering competitively priced flights, making air travel accessible for budget-conscious travelers.
  • Extensive Network
    As a subsidiary of Lufthansa, Eurowings offers an extensive network of flights across Europe and other destinations, providing travelers with numerous options.
  • Flexible Fare Options
    Eurowings provides a variety of fare categories including Basic, Smart, and BIZclass, which allow passengers to choose based on their budget and service needs.
  • Part of Lufthansa Group
    Being part of the Lufthansa Group provides Eurowings passengers with added reliability and access to benefits such as the Miles & More frequent flyer program.

Possible disadvantages of Eurowings

  • Limited Long-Haul Options
    While Eurowings has an extensive European network, their long-haul flight options are relatively limited compared to other airlines.
  • Additional Fees
    Passengers may incur additional fees for services such as seat selection, baggage, and onboard refreshments, which can increase the cost of travel.
  • Mixed Customer Reviews
    Customer experiences with Eurowings can vary, with some travelers reporting issues with customer service and punctuality.
  • Basic In-Flight Amenities
    The in-flight amenities in economy class are relatively basic, with additional costs for snacks and beverages, which may not suit all travelers.
